I’ve got 2 kids at Barton Hills. Kinder and first. So far, we’ve had a good experience. Class sizes tend to be a bit smaller and I feel like both my kids have had a really easy transition from preschool to elementary school because it isn’t overwhelming. Kinder teachers are exactly what you’d want for you kid-excited, engaged, and communicate well with parents. Both kids seem to be progressing appropriately. It is a very active PTA and parent base-which is a good thing, in my opinion. Parents communicate well with each other and help each other out. I know I’ve randomly asked another parent for a favor and the parent was happy to help out.

This is a topic that hits home. I’ve been there too. Your hair loss will likely slow while you are pregnant. But after you give birth, the shedding is really intense, in my experience. Always ask your dermatologist, but I was told not to use minox while breastfeeding. I breastfed for a year and while it did suck to see my hair fall out so much, the benefits of breastfeeding outweighed negatives of hair loss. I’ve been on minox for almost 5 months now and I’ve definitely seen improvement. I also took some higher dose iron multivitamins prescribed by doctor as well to help get ferritin levels back up. While I was pregnant and breastfeeding, I tried rosemary oil. I didn’t see less shedding but it smelled really nice. I started to derma-roll at the tail end of breastfeeding but didn’t have the time or patience to do it. No matter what you decide to do, everything will be okay. ❤️
